As you can see this is a amaze-balls blue polish with a bazillion sparkles! Here is the description - "Aphrodite's Fish - a gorgeous royal blue holo jellyish base with red-violet-blue duo chrome shifting pigment, baby blue micro shreds and violet to red to orange UCC flakies." Formula is so smooth. As you can see, two coats are pretty much all you need, but three makes it super opaque. I couldn't stop looking at all the pretties in there when I wore it.
